Formidable

The rain lashed against the window, 

louder than I’d ever heard before. 

Sounding like a herd of elephants, 

battering at the glass.

Pools of water gathered on the patio, 

inviting, to the robins that sheltered 

in the nearby oak tree. 

The army of ants I saw earlier,

now hidden in the comfort of their den. 

The cat next door cried to be let into

the warmth of his abode, 

 soaked down to his skin. 

The rain lashed against the window

taking the world as its prisoner, 

with its formidable drops

attacking everything in its path.
